With increasing regulatory scrutiny and a constant drive for transparency, understanding the differences between IFRS and UK GAAP has become essential for finance professionals. The ability to apply these frameworks confidently can transform how financial statements are prepared, interpreted, and communicated.

This course demystifies the key distinctions between IFRS and UK GAAP, equipping you with the practical insight needed to enhance accuracy, improve comparability, and uphold compliance in today’s complex reporting environment.

WHAT YOU’LL LEARN
By the end of this course, you will be able to:

• Identify and articulate the key differences between IFRS and UK GAAP.
• Apply relevant accounting principles to ensure compliance with both frameworks.
• Analyse financial statements through the lens of IFRS and UK GAAP to enhance clarity and accuracy.
• Communicate effectively with stakeholders about the implications of these standards.

WHO IS THIS COURSE FOR?
Designed for finance professionals, accountants, and auditors responsible for preparing or reviewing financial statements. Ideal for those seeking to deepen their understanding of UK GAAP and IFRS frameworks and their practical impact on compliance and reporting.

COURSE STRUCTURE
A 3-hour high-impact, live online workshop combining expert input, discussion, and practical examples.

Session overview
• Options available under the UK financial reporting regime
• Anticipated changes to UK GAAP and their implications
• Key balance sheet differences
• Key income statement differences
• Common similarities and interpretive challenges
